US generals tell Donald Trump destroying Iranian vessel near Sri Lanka was fun
US President Donald Trump stated he questioned the choice to sink an Iranian warship near Sri Lanka last week. At a rally in Hebron, Kentucky, he mentioned asking military leaders why the ship was destroyed instead of being captured. “I asked, why did we kill them? Why didn’t we just take them and use them in our Navy?” he shared with his supporters. Trump also noted that one of his generals told him sinking the ship was better, stating, “Sir, it’s a lot more fun.” The Iranian navy frigate was hit by a torpedo and sunk by a US submarine in international waters close to Sri Lanka, resulting in numerous sailor fatalities. Currently, the remains of 84 Iranian sailors are stored in two mobile cold storage units at the Galle National Hospital. The Galle Chief Magistrate, Sameera Dodangoda, issued an order yesterday (11) for the bodies to be handed over to officials from the Iranian Embassy in Sri Lanka, according to an Ada Derana reporter. The Magistrate instructed the hospital’s director to release the remains to representatives of the Iranian embassy, following a request made to the Galle Magistrate’s Court by the Galle Harbour Police.
